Description

This exceptional detached thatched cottage, originally dating back to 1710, has been meticulously refurbished to an outstanding standard, seamlessly combining period character with contemporary sophistication. Set within a peaceful no-through road, the property enjoys a picturesque setting just moments from a mainline station with direct links to London Waterloo.

At the heart of the home lies a beautifully crafted Neptune kitchen, thoughtfully designed around both style and functionality. Featuring a Belfast sink, integrated dishwasher, instant hot tap, and a striking Rangemaster Elise 110 cooker alongside an American-style fridge freezer, this is a space perfectly suited to both everyday living and entertaining. A separate utility room/pantry provides additional practicality. 

The ground floor offers a welcoming reception hall leading to elegant and versatile living spaces. A superb sitting room with open fireplace and seagrass flooring creates a warm and inviting atmosphere, while a generous dining/sitting room with exposed beams opens directly onto the garden, enhancing the home’s connection to its surroundings. A stylishly appointed shower room completes the ground floor accommodation.

Upstairs, three well-proportioned bedrooms are complemented by a beautifully finished bathroom featuring a classic cast iron roll-top bath. A walk-in wardrobe adds a touch of luxury, while seagrass carpeting throughout reinforces the home’s natural, refined aesthetic.

Externally, the property truly excels. The landscaped gardens offer a variety of spaces for relaxation and entertaining, including a charming courtyard, lawned areas, a pond, and a productive vegetable garden. A detached home office/library, fitted with modern thermostat-controlled heating, provides an ideal work-from-home retreat. The cottage benefits from a complete re-thatch in August 2023 using high-quality straw and protective wire mesh, ensuring longevity and peace of mind for years to come.

Located within a thriving village community, the property enjoys easy access to local amenities, countryside walks, and nearby market towns, offering the perfect balance of rural tranquillity and connectivity.
